Overview
Chatuchak Market is one of the largest markets in the world, featuring a vast array of goods ranging from clothing and accessories to food and antiques. It's a unique cultural experience and a shopper's paradise.
One of the largest markets in the world, offering a unique shopping experience and a glimpse into Thai culture.
